What is the origin of the jstars courtyard?
What is the origin of the jstars courtyard? Qiao Family Courtyard was built in Qianlong period of Qing Dynasty, and was rebuilt many times in Tongzhi, Guangxu and early Republic of China. Although time has spanned two centuries, it has maintained the integrity of architectural style. The Qiao Family Courtyard covers an area of 8,724.8 square meters and consists of 6 courtyards, 19 small courtyards and 3 13 houses. From a height, the overall layout is double happiness, and the building is castle-like. Surrounding 10 meter high totally enclosed watertight brick wall, the courtyard is adjacent to the courtyard, and the house is connected with the house. Rows of hanging mountains, resting mountains, hard peaks, rolling shed roofs and flat roofs all have passages connected with towers. The whole hospital is separated by a straight tunnel into six courtyards. There is a yard in the yard and a garden in the yard. Siheyuan, Chuanxin Courtyard, Weird Courtyard, Jiaodaoyuan and Suite Courtyard, with their doors and windows, oak eaves, step stones and railings, are all beautifully shaped and have their own characteristics. The brick carvings in the yard leave a deep impression on people. Ridge carving, wall carving, screen carving and column carving ... take people's allusions, flowers, birds and animals, piano, chess, calligraphy and painting as the theme, each with its own style. The whole house has a double "hi" shape, which is not only full of overall beauty, but also has its own characteristics in local architecture. All the scenes of the movie "Hanging the Red Lantern High" and the TV series "Qiao Family Courtyard" were shot in Qiao Family Courtyard, which attracted great attention all over the world.

In the history of national commercial development in China, "Shanxi Merchants" is a legendary name. Those ancient pawn shops, money houses, banks and business houses are the symbols and marks left by Shanxi merchants in history. In recent years, in the film and television industry, "Shanxi Merchants" is an inexhaustible treasure house-from Baiyin Valley to Longzhou to Changjinyuan Bank, those ancient houses are like a never-ending drama, telling deja vu stories every day.

"The imperial family and the country look at the Forbidden City, and every household looks at the Qiao family." Following the Qiao Family Courtyard, Wang Family Courtyard, Cao Family Courtyard, Qu Family Courtyard and Changjia Manor appeared one after another. Dark corridors, gorgeous eaves, generous doorways and stilt roofs provide modern people with an inexhaustible sense of commerce in the name of traditional culture.
